User Scenario

These scenarios should describe the user, and outline in detail what their goals are when they reach the Learning Commons site.

Our target student is in 1st or 2nd Year

USER 1: Struggling Student (Writing & Research Courses)

  • Student needs to write a paper
  • Needs to use services in the Library
  • Needs to conduct research
  • Looking for a person to help them with Academics (Tutor, Coach)
  • Needs examples of what they should be doing

USER 2: Struggling Student (Problem-based Courses)

  • Breakdown large concept into manageable parts
  • I need to practice this concept
  • Need to retain information
  • Organize large amounts of information

USER 3: High Achievers

  • I need to not feel stressed
  • I need MORE --> I want to learn something that will make me that much better
  • I need a quiet place to study

USER 4: New-to-UBC

  • I need to know what services are available to me
  • I need to know where stuff is
  • I need to know how to be a university student
  • I need to know how to do stuff in the LC
  • First Year Students
    • I need to transition from high school
  • Transfer Students
    • I need advising
  • Mature Students
    • I need community

USER 5: Crisis/Panic Mode Students

  • I need academic help
    • I need to talk to a person
  • I need a plan of attack

USER 6: Specialty User (International, commuter, online, aboriginal, residence)

  • I need information specific to me
  • Online user resources

USER 7: Educators/Staff/Faculty/Student Leaders

  • I need more information/contacts
  • I need context about this information
  • Resources to disseminate to students
